          Through out the class, ECMP 355, I have had experiences with people that have helped me to learn socially.  This class is a challenging class because there is a lot of information that I did not have any previous experience with.  The challenges in the class were helped by the people that I was in the class with.  I did a lot of my online sessions at the university with a few other girls.  It was nice to do the class there because if I had a question those girls would help me and I would help them as much as I possible could.  When the whole group of us did not understand something we would work through it together.  It was a really good learning environment.  This is an idea that I would take into my future classroom.  I feel that in a classroom it is important for students to problem solve and to come up with a solution without always asking the teacher.  This is what we did in a group and it made me realize that putting students in groups is very beneficial because they all have different background knowledge and perspective that can help to solve the problem.
